+mytek Posted October 16, 2018 Share Posted October 16, 2018 The ST mouse when cleaned works pretty good, but my biggest complaint would be the buttons as compared to more modern mice. They just feel very clunky and require much more effort to click. As for the PeST adapter working for USB mice, it is no different than the Moustari, and some of the other Atari/Amiga mouse adapters in this regard, requiring that the USB mouse also support PS/2 protocol. Unfortunately no modern USB mouse built over the last decade still does. I do have a couple of USB mice that are dual protocol, and they do work utilizing the green passive USB to PS/2 adapter that they came with. So the key is, if it came with this adapter from the factory, it should work. Quote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
flashjazzcat Posted October 16, 2018 Author Share Posted October 16, 2018 (edited) Yep: the ST mice are awful to use, although they do look good with an XE system. That's why I recommend third-party ST/Amiga mice, many of which are quite pleasant in use, and all of which plug straight into the joystick port without any additional fuss. There is (or was) even a build of the GOS which works directly with Amiga mice (no need for a switchable ST/Amiga device). Obviously when things progress somewhat, you'd just install the relevant mouse driver (Amiga or ST).
